Subject: [PATCH 0/3] KVM: x86: Accelerate reading CR3 for guest debug
Date: Fri, 21 Nov 2025 19:32:01 +0000 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20251121193204.952988-1-yosry.ahmed@linux.dev> (raw)
Some guest debuggers use the value of CR3 to attribute a debug event to
a guest process. Providing CR3 in the debug info makes this
significantly faster than doing KVM_GET_SREGS every time, so add support
for that. Also extend the debug_regs selftest to cover this.
Yosry Ahmed (3):
KVM: x86: Add CR3 to guest debug info
KVM: selftests: Use TEST_ASSERT_EQ() in debug_regs
KVM: selftests: Verify CR3 in debug_regs
